20 U.S.C. § 4505

U.S. CodeFederal
Recipient’s choice of institution

Fellowship recipients may attend any institution of higher education in the United States with an accredited graduate program which offers courses of study or training which emphasize the origins of the Constitution of the United States, its principles, its development, and its comparison with other forms of government, as determined according to criteria established by the Foundation. (Pub. L. 99–500, § 101(b) [title VIII, § 806], Oct. 18, 1986, 100 Stat. 1783–39, 1783–77, and Pub. L. 99–591, § 101(b) [title VIII, § 806], Oct. 30, 1986, 100 Stat. 3341–39, 3341–77.) Editorial Notes Codification Pub. L. 99–591 is a corrected version of Pub. L. 99–500.
